Registered Practical Nurse
About the role
Job Summary & Requirements The Registered Practical Nurse (RPN) is a professional caregiver who is responsible and accountable for providing quality patient care within a delivery model in accordance with the philosophy, policies and standards of care of the Royal Victoria Regional Health Centre, the College of Nurses of Ontario (CNO) and all relevant legislation. This position is within the oncology systemic therapy department at the Hudson Regional Cancer Centre.
Must have the ability to learn about, from and with other members of the patient care team to foster a strong interprofessional model of care.
This position will be required to work and train in any area of the Oncology Outpatient clinics or programs.
Education:
- Current College of Nurses certificate of competence required
- Current BCLS required
- RPN Oncology Nursing Certificate required
Experience:
- Current progressive acute care nursing experience within the last two years required
- Recent experience in one of the following areas: oncology, palliative care or ambulatory care required
- DeSouza Foundations in Oncology or equivalent required
- Experience with peripheral IV insertion and maintenance required
- Experience with PICC management, blood product administration and wound care management required
- Experience with oncology and hematology patients preferred
- RPN Health Assessment or equivalent preferred
Competencies:
- Excellent organizational skills (oral & written), conflict resolution and decision-making skills
- Functions independently within scope of practice
- Must be willing to participate in continuing education programs
- Membership in RPNAO, CANO or equivalent preferred
About Royal Victoria Regional Health Centre
Royal Victoria Regional Health Centre, located in Barrie, Ontario, provides safe, high-quality care for residents across a large geographical region including Simcoe County and the District of Muskoka. The area is home to more than 450,000 residents, with half of RVH’s patients living outside the City of Barrie.
As the largest health centre in North Simcoe Muskoka, RVH provides highly specialized services, and technology not found anywhere else in the region. This includes the only interventional radiology suites for minimally invasive surgeries, vascular services, advanced stroke care, as well as dedicated trauma rooms in its large Emergency department. RVH is also home to the Hudson Regional Cancer Centre, Simcoe Muskoka Regional Heart Program, Simcoe Muskoka Regional Child and Youth Program and the RVH Regional Renal Program meaning distance is no longer a factor for residents receiving lifesaving treatment.
